
In the ever-volatile world of stock markets, tracking the performance of key indices and their constituents is crucial for investors. Recently, several prominent stocks in the Nifty50 index have seen significant declines from their 52-week highs. Here’s a detailed look at some of the notable performers and what these trends might indicate.
Notable Declines:
Tata Motors: Leading the pack, Tata Motors has seen a staggering decline of 41.76% from its 52-week high. The automotive sector has faced numerous challenges, including supply chain disruptions and fluctuating demand.
Adani Enterprises: Close behind, Adani Enterprises has dropped by 40.60%. The Adani Group has been under scrutiny, impacting investor confidence.
Trent:Trent, a retail giant, has experienced a 38.93% decline. The retail sector has been volatile, with changing consumer behavior post-pandemic.
Hero MotoCorp:The two-wheeler manufacturer has seen a 37.94% drop, reflecting the broader struggles in the automotive industry.
Coal India: With a 33.75% decline, Coal India’s performance mirrors the global shift towards renewable energy and away from coal.
The declines are not isolated to a single sector but span across various industries:
Automotive: Companies like Tata Motors and Hero MotoCorp highlight the ongoing challenges in the automotive sector.
Energy: Coal India and Bharat Petroleum Corp have seen significant drops, reflecting the global energy transition.
Banking and Finance: IndusInd Bank and Axis Bank have also faced declines, indicating broader economic pressures.
Market Sentiment
The significant drops from 52-week highs suggest a cautious or bearish sentiment among investors. Factors such as global economic uncertainty, inflationary pressures, and sector-specific challenges are likely contributors.
